Spring roller
Another important tool in the process of making fiberglass parts is used in some stages of production due to its special characteristics. This type of roller, which has a flexible and springy structure, is mainly used for compacting and evenly distributing composite materials such as fiberglass and resin. The springy feature of this roller allows it to work in different conditions and angles and to shape different surfaces.
Features of the spring roller:
- High flexibility:
- The most important feature of the spring roller is its flexibility. This flexibility allows this roller to be used on parts with irregular shapes or curved surfaces. The spring roller can easily move on such surfaces and distribute the resin evenly.
 
 - Effective compaction:
- By pressing the layers of fiberglass and resin, the spring roller removes air bubbles from between the layers and helps to effectively compact these layers. This makes the final piece stronger and prevents weak points in the structure of the piece.
 
 - Compatibility with types of resins:
- These types of rollers are suitable for working with different types of resins such as polyester, epoxy, and vinyl ester. Its spring structure helps resin materials penetrate the fiberglass surface well and create a uniform distribution on the surface of the part.
 
 - Use in difficult areas:
- Due to its flexible design, the spring roller can be used in difficult-to-reach areas that conventional rollers cannot work in. This feature is especially useful on complex parts or surfaces with irregular shapes.
 
 
Benefits of using a spring roller:
- Improving the quality of the part’s surface:
- With uniform compression and proper distribution of the resin, the surface of the final part will be smoother and without defects. This helps reduce problems such as cracking or surface defects.
 
 - Increase production speed:
- The flexibility of the spring roller allows the operator to work faster and more accurately, especially when complex or large parts need to be produced. This increases efficiency and reduces production time.
 
 - Reduce resin consumption:
- This roller helps to distribute the resin better and prevents its excess consumption. Therefore, not only are production costs reduced, but the final product will also be more optimized in terms of weight and strength.
 
 - Increase the durability and lifespan of parts:
- Using a spring roller, the fiberglass layers are well compressed and air bubbles are eliminated. This makes the final parts stronger and more durable.
 
 
Applications of spring rollers in various industries:
- Automotive industry: In the manufacture of composite automotive parts that require high precision and strength, the spring roller is used to distribute resin and compress fiberglass layers.
 - Aerospace industry: In the production of lightweight and durable parts for aircraft and spacecraft, the spring roller helps improve the quality of the parts and reduce their weight.
 - Marine industries: For the manufacture of boats and marine parts that require high resistance to moisture and harsh environmental conditions, the spring roller is used to fully bond the fiberglass layers together and create appropriate strength.
